Proverbs 22:16 - King James 2000 He that oppresses the poor to increase his riches, and he that gives to the rich, shall surely come to poverty. Tuilleadh leaganachaKing James Version (Oxford) 1769 He that oppresseth the poor to increase his riches, And he that giveth to the rich, shall surely come to want. Amplified Bible - Classic Edition He who oppresses the poor to get gain for himself and he who gives to the rich–both will surely come to want. American Standard Version (1901) He that oppresseth the poor to increase his gain, And he that giveth to the rich, shall come only to want. Common English Bible Oppressing the poor to get rich and giving to the wealthy lead only to poverty. Catholic Public Domain Version Whoever slanders the poor, so as to augment his own riches, will give it away to one who is richer, and will be in need. Douay-Rheims version of The Bible - 1752 version He that oppresseth the poor, to increase his own riches, shall himself give to one that is richer, and shall be in need. |
